VB6实现的RMVB简易播放器功能介绍

版权申诉
0 下载量 86 浏览量 更新于2024-10-02 收藏 5.16MB RAR 举报
资源摘要信息:"Dodrag_播放器_vb6" 本资源是一个由Visual Basic 6.0(简称VB6)编程语言编写的简易视频播放器项目,项目文件包含了多个文件,主要功能为支持RMVB格式的视频文件播放。RMVB是RealMedia Variable Bitrate的缩写,是一种采用可变比特率编码的视频文件格式,常用于网络视频流媒体。此类视频通常具有较小的文件体积和较高的压缩效率。 以下是资源中的关键知识点: 1. VB6编程语言:VB6是微软公司发布的一种面向对象的编程语言,其语言简单易学,通过事件驱动编程模型让初学者能够快速开发出应用程序。它主要应用于Windows平台的桌面应用程序开发。 2. 简易播放器开发:在本资源中,开发者使用VB6创建了一个基础的播放器界面和控制逻辑。虽然“简易”,但可能包括了视频播放、视频控制(如暂停、停止、播放、快进、快退)等基础功能。 3. RMVB视频解码:本资源中提到的RMVB视频解码功能指的是播放器能够解码并播放RMVB格式的视频文件。通常,这种功能需要特定的解码库或组件支持,这可能是项目中的一个关键组件,如“RMVB视频解码.exe”。 4. 项目文件结构:资源包含多个文件,其中一些是VB6的工程文件,例如: - Module2.bas:包含程序所需的变量声明、函数和过程定义等的模块文件。 - 拖动窗体.bas:可能包含对窗体拖动操作的代码。 - XPButton1.ctl和XPButton1.ctx:分别为VB6中的自定义控件文件和对应的上下文文件,用于实现特定外观和行为的按钮控件。 - 主界面.frm、Menu.frm、查找.frm、re.frm:这些是VB6的窗体文件,代表了用户界面中不同的窗口,如主界面、菜单界面、查找功能界面等。 5. 拖动窗体功能:文件“拖动窗体.bas”表明项目可能支持拖动窗体的功能,这是一种常见的用户交互方式,允许用户通过鼠标操作移动窗口位置。 6. 用户界面:VB6程序的用户界面(UI)通常由多个窗体(.frm文件)构成,每个窗体负责显示特定的信息或提供特定的交互。资源中的窗体文件暗示了播放器可能具有菜单、查找视频文件等功能。 7. 文件扩展名: - .bas:这是VB6的源代码文件,用于存储程序代码。 - .ctl:VB6控件文件,用于定义自定义控件。 - .ctx:VB6控件上下文文件,包含控件属性设置。 - .frm:VB6窗体文件,用于设计和定义程序的用户界面。 - .exe:可执行文件,用于运行VB6项目。 由于资源中未包含实际的源代码,以上内容基于文件名称和描述进行推断。完整的学习和使用此资源需要对VB6编程以及视频播放器开发有一定的了解,并且在实际的开发环境中实践操作。开发者还需要获取并嵌入适当的RMVB视频解码库或组件以确保播放功能正常运作。